The Farmington Independent and the Rosemount Town Pages make up the unique operation of one group of employees producing two separate newspapers - the Farmington Independent and the Rosemount Town Pages. News content in each is separate, although the two cities are located eight miles apart. This demonstrates the commitment to keep each product local. Several special products are also produced. Some examples are a Community Guide, Sports Preview and a graduation section. The Minnesota Newspaper Association recognized the Farmington Independent with first place for "use of Photography" and "Advertising Excellence" at the 2001 convention.

At the 2001 Minnesota Newspaper Association convention, the Farmington Independent took first place for "Use of Photography" and "Advertising Excellence." The paper took second for "Sports Reporting" and "General Excellence." An individual award was also won by Chad Richardson for a "Photo Story." In April 2001, Independent editor Nathan Hansen won a national award for environmental reporting.

Special Products:
We produce a map of the city every other year. We publish a Community Guide on an annual basis. We publish a Fall Sports Preview, a graduation section and a section commemorating the annual community celebration, Dew Days, annually.

What makes our operation unique:
Our five employees are responsible for two separate newspapers -- the Farmington Independent and the Rosemount Town Pages. The news content in each is separate, although the two cities are located just eight miles apart. We think that shows our commitment to keep eaching product as local as possible.

Highlights of the community:
The highlight in each city has to do with each city's respective summertime celebration. Rosemount's is Leprechaun days, held in July, and Farmington's is Dew Days, held in June.

Recreational activities:
Rosemount has two Paintball fields, and wide-open spaces for a variety of recreational opportunities. Farmington boasts great public hunting land, and good fishing on the Vermillion River.

City population:
Rosemount has a population of 16,000. Farmington has a population of 14,000.

Major source of information:
We are the only two papers in the area that readers pay to receive. That residents are willing to pay for our products, when there are two other free products in the market, showing just how well we cover the news in each respective city.
